Where can I find the Service Center of Panasonic in the Philippines?
Panasonic Service Center Philippines Map
Here is their address
548 Unit C Facilities Building, Shaw Boulevard
Mandaluyong CityHotline : (02) 284-2272 to 73
Fax : (02) 284-2303
